OP, I noticed you are getting it from MRT. After I shopped, CJ Pony was much cheaper. MRT "should" also get it from 3DC, but I think they charge more for shipping, etc. CJ Pony is free shipping.
Also make sure you don't get it from American Muscle... they don't sell the 3DC prepainted. You will get a copy of it, with NO black gurney flap.

Update after about 2.5 mos of ownership. Spoiler is holding up great...prepainted piece is all solid and good. This was the first prepainted piece I have ever purchased and was worried about the quality, etc... But man, I am loving this spoiler to this day. Maybe even more so now. Lol.
Folks who see it car shows all comment on it. Worries me that I will get copied over and over lol.... ESP in my small hometown.
Anyways, I highly recommend getting it. Best spoiler
